Introduction 🎮
2048 isn’t just a game—it’s a phenomenon. What started as a weekend coding project by Gabriele Cirulli in 2014 quickly became one of the most addictive and widely played browser games of all time. Gameplay: Simple Yet Deep 🧩⚡
To get the elusive 2048 tile 🎯, players must match equal numbers on numbered tiles on a 4x4 grid in the puzzle game 2048.The guidelines are straightforward:
Swipe (or use arrow keys) to move all tiles in one direction. ↔️
Matching numbers merge into their sum (e.g., two "2" tiles become
a "4"). ➕
A new "2" or "4" tile spawns after every move. 🆕
The game ends when the grid fills up with no possible merges. ❌
